“It’s time to beat the heat and get into the holiday spirit with Christmas in July at Grace Cafe, a ministry of Arch Street UMC” says Kristi Painter, Coordinator of Programming at Arch Street UMC’s new partner nonprofit, The Center Philadelphia.  Grace Cafe offers a community meal on Sunday evenings and a drop-in resource center during the week (Daytime Services). Both serve the unhoused community in Center City Philadelphia.

“We are grateful to receive a ton of donations during the winter holiday season each year, but our programs are in need of resources year round,” said Painter in her appeal. “Christmas in July is a fantastic opportunity for you to support your Philly neighbors! Each day of the week leading up to the 25th of July, we will be asking for new or used donations of some of the most needed items for our guests.

There will be a shoe day, a bag day, and more. On the 25th, we will be raising money for our big wish list item– donations toward new railings for the ramp that leads to our fellowship hall to make our building more accessible for our guests (contribute here!).”
